World premiere of brain orchestra →
Led by an “emotional conductor” and a traditional one, music and video change in time with the performers’ brain waves and heart rate. According to the work’s producer, the orchestra aims to “see what the brain can do without the body”.

Falling into a black hole might not be good for your health, but at least the view would be fine. A new simulation shows what you might see on your way towards the black hole’s crushing central singularity. The research could help physicists understand the apparently paradoxical fate of matter and energy in a black hole. — NewScientist
